"The care my dad received was amazing"

About: Community Nursing Services / Nottingham West End of Life Co-ordinator

(as a service user),

My father was on the caseload for end of life care. As a team member of these community teams he was under I knew I would get exceptional care. I know our palliative care is amazing and that we have great pride in delivering this service, however as a service user I have now experienced this first hand.

The care my dad received was amazing, they made sure he was treated with respect and dignity at all times, they spent time listening and discussing his concerns and treatment. They supported my mum and us as a family and made difficult time for us easier. My dad was able to die at home supported and comfortable. We can not thank them enough.

As a team member, I had the most amazing support, from my head of service, both my clinical leads, our community matron, my DNS and every member of the team.

They have been amazing. I am sure they do not even realise how much they have helped me and continue doing so.
